Tour Details

The tour details at Ebony Forest Reserve Chamarel offer a full day of immersive experiences amidst the lush surroundings of Mauritius. Visitors can expect to engage in various activities that showcase the beauty and diversity of this unique destination. Here are some highlights of the tour:

  1. Guided Tours: Explore the Flycatcher Forest, Ridgeline Trail, Sublime Point, and Piton Canot with knowledgeable guides.

  2. Forest Restoration: Learn about the ongoing efforts to restore and preserve the forest’s natural beauty and ecosystem.

  3. Bird Sightings: Keep an eye out for rare bird species that call the reserve home, offering fantastic opportunities for bird watching.

  4. Scenic Views: Enjoy breathtaking vistas and captivating landscapes as you hike through this picturesque setting.

Practical Information

Visitors to the Ebony Forest Reserve Chamarel can find essential practical information to enhance their experience in exploring this unique destination. The reserve offers wheelchair access, ensuring inclusivity for all visitors. Safety measures are in place, with infant seats available and children required to be accompanied at all times.

It’s important to note that the tour isn’t recommended for pregnant travelers. The excursion operates in all weather conditions, so visitors should dress appropriately. Groups are limited to a maximum of 8 travelers, allowing for a more personalized experience.

These practical considerations help ensure a safe and enjoyable journey through the Ebony Forest Reserve Chamarel.
